Understanding the Basics of Blackjack

Before diving deep into strategies, it's essential to understand the core mechanics that govern Blackjack. The game's objective is straightforward: acquire a hand totaling as close to 21 as possible without exceeding it. A standard game is played with 6 to 8 decks of 52 cards, shuffled together to maintain randomness and reduce the effectiveness of card counting.

Each card carries a specific value; cards 2 through 10 hold their face value, while face cards (Kings, Queens, and Jacks) are valued at 10, and Aces can count as either 1 or 11, depending on the player's hand. Players are dealt two cards initially and can choose to "hit" (take another card) or "stand" (keep their current hand) based on their total points and the dealer's visible card.

Common Blackjack Terms to Know

  • Blackjack: A hand consisting of an Ace and a 10-point card.
  • Dealer Bust: When the dealer’s hand exceeds 21, leading to a win for all remaining players.
  • Push: A result where both dealer and player have the same total, leading to no loss or gain.
  • Soft Hand: A hand containing an Ace counted as 11.

How to Play: Step-by-Step Guide

To excel at Blackjack, players should familiarize themselves with the step-by-step process of gameplay. Here’s how a typical game unfolds:

  1. Place Bets: Players place their bets in the designated betting area.
  2. Dealing Cards: Each player and the dealer receive two cards, one of the dealer's cards is face up.
  3. Player Decisions: Players decide whether to hit, stand, double down, or split based on their hands and the dealer’s open card.
  4. Dealer’s Turn: After all players finish, the dealer plays according to predefined house rules (usually hitting until reaching at least 17).
  5. Resolve Bets: Winning hands are paid out, and losing bets are collected.

Card Counting Techniques Explained

Card counting is a method used by players to gain an advantage by keeping track of the ratio of high to low-value cards remaining in the deck. Basic card counting systems, like the Hi-Lo strategy, assign value to cards and allow players to adjust their bets based on the count. While not illegal, many casinos employ measures to deter card counting, emphasizing the need for players to blend betting strategies and card counting discreetly.

Identifying Casino Odds and House Edge

The house edge in Blackjack can vary depending on the rules in play at the table. Generally, the house edge is around 0.5% for players who use basic strategy.
